Upload your test file using the LibriVox Uploader. https://librivox.org/login/uploader
The username and password for the uploader are:
In the MC dropdown box, select “tests-tests”/Start Upload
Copy the link it provides when the upload is complete, and post it in a new thread in the Listeners and Editors Wanted forum. Say something like, “One-Minute Test for Your Name”
A more experienced volunteer will listen to it within a few days and get back to you with any comments, help you work out the kinks (if any), and when you get the OK from an admin, you can begin claiming sections to read. Meanwhile, there are lots of tips and video tutorials in our Wiki (linked to at the top of each forum page) to help you prepare to get out there and enjoy yourself. Welcome to the LV Playground!
